EP037: Jasper Discusses Questions from the Airbnb Academy FB group
Summary
This article discusses revenue management strategies for short-term rentals, emphasizing the importance of scheduled pricing routines, analyzing booking data, and understanding the nuances of the STR market compared to hotels. Hosts should implement a daily and weekly pricing routine, paying close attention to booking behavior, and be prepared to adjust pricing based on demand signals.
Key Insights
- •Weekends require different attention than weekdays.
- •Early bookings can indicate underpricing or upcoming events.
- •Revenue management must be scheduled, not reactive.
Action Items
- ✓Review every booking to reveal pricing and demand signals.Effort: lowImpact: medium
- ✓Make small daily price changes to increase exposure on OTAs.Effort: lowImpact: medium
- ✓Spot mistakes in minimum stays and pricing settings.Effort: lowImpact: medium
